Frequently Asked Questions about Northeast Memphis
What type of rentals are currently available in Northeast Memphis?
There are currently 156 Apartments for Rent in Northeast Memphis, TN with pricing that ranges from $745 to $7,270. There are also 514 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Northeast Memphis ranging from $800 to $6,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Northeast Memphis?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Northeast Memphis ranges from $800 to $6,500 with an average monthly rent of $2,373.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Northeast Memphis?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Northeast Memphis range from $995 to $7,184,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,150 to $2,625.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,595 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,550.
